Marine Monitoring for Small-Scale Beach Replenishment at Maalaea, Maui, Hawaii

Marine and coastal environmental monitoring was carried out on a monthly basis from October 2002 to September 2003 along approximately 300 m of shoreline in Maalaea, South Maui. The purpose was to establish a baseline of physical, chemical, and biological conditions from which comparisons could be made during and after beach replenishment to determine the extent of environmental impacts from this activity. The small-scale beach replenishment project consisted of the addition of 3,000 cubic yards of inland dune sand with less than 1 percent fine particles at the number 200 sieve. The sand was placed at the Kanai A Nalu condominiums over the period of June 2-6, 2003. Water quality monitoring was conducted on a daily basis during the sand placement, or construction period, and three times within the five days following the completion of sand placement. Monthly monitoring resumed one month after the sand placement, for three months. Of the water quality parameters monitored, turbidity was the only parameter that appeared to be affected by the sand placement, increasing by up to 21.63 nepha-lometric turbidity unit (NTU) over pre-construc-tion levels. On average, turbidity levels increased by 2.22 NTU, and returned to pre-construction levels within five days following the completion of construction. Beach profiles revealed increases in the seaward extent of the beach in the month following construction that did not greatly exceed the seaward extent seven months prior to sand placement. The beach face experienced an average inflation of 0 m to approximately 0.5 m above levels of the previous year, and up to 1 m above pre-nourishment levels. Video analysis revealed that the bottom composition prior to sand placement consisted mainly of sand and algae; after nourishment, sand coverage increased and algae coverage decreased. Fish counts revealed an increase in fish following beach nourishment; however this may have been influenced by the improved visibility following the sand placement. Ghost crabs, which had disappeared entirely before the beach replenishment due to the lack of sand, were well established within three months following sand placement. Sediment trap analysis was inconclusive due to frequent damage to the sediment traps by high surf events.
